Understanding Java Developer Roles And Responsibilities: Your Complete Information To Hiring Proper

Project stakeholders perceive the general vision of what needs to be accomplished and need the talents of a Java Developer to complete their project. Program structure is a key perform that Java Developers present during this process. Java is a concurrent, class-based, and object-oriented programming language. It was initially designed to have as few implementation dependencies as potential, which led to the term “write as quickly as, run anywhere” (WORA).

Being a Java Developer opens many nice opportunities for you within the IT industry, from established roles to transformative and extremely evolving ones. Are you continue to uncertain of whether or not you might have the right mix of skills for landing a job as a Java Developer? There are a few methods you’ll find a way to acquire the required expertise to get that job you’ve all the time wanted. Other Java developer duties embrace Software maintenance and optimization, project management, leading and liaising, and vendor management. A QA person is answerable for making tools that permits automating processes that determine and verify the software program quality. They verify if the work on new options didn’t cause errors within the already present and functioning system.

role of java developer

Preserve & Optimize Methods

Java is a versatile, object-oriented language that’s extensively used for building enterprise-level applications, mobile functions, and web-based options. The function of a Java Developer encompasses quite lots of obligations which are essential for the profitable growth and upkeep of software program projects. This article delves into the multifaceted position of a Java Developer, shedding light on the necessary thing obligations that define their day-to-day actions. From writing clear, environment friendly code to collaborating with cross-functional groups, Java Builders play an important position in bringing software program projects to life. We will discover the talents and tools that are indispensable for success on this function, as nicely as the impact of Java on fashionable software improvement practices. For Java developers aspiring to maneuver into management roles, such as team lead, project supervisor, or technical architect, a mixture of technical experience and gentle expertise is important.

Application Growth

The function of a Java Developer is multifaceted, requiring a blend of technical expertise, problem-solving expertise, and effective communication. Java, recognized for its portability, scalability, and robustness, is broadly used in numerous domains, together with net functions, cell applications, enterprise solutions, and cloud-based providers. Java Developers are liable for designing, implementing, and maintaining Java-based applications, guaranteeing they meet each functional and non-functional requirements. A Java Developer is a specialist who designs, builds, and maintains purposes using Java.

The code you write today would possibly just energy someone’s digital life tomorrow. The median wage for Indian-based Java Developers is over Rs. four.5 LPA and goes up depending on career stage, expertise, and location. These information make the function of a java developer a lucrative one with long-term advantages. Job DescriptionWe are on the lookout for developers who need to help us design Avant-grade scalable merchandise to satisfy our swift-growing enterprise. We are constructing out a group and looking for a number of levels but you should have a minimal of 3 years of programming expertise java developer course. Relational Databases and Object Relational Mapping (ORM)The approach for changing knowledge between incompatible kind techniques utilizing object-oriented programming languages.

One such duty is being a key member of the staff who liaises with stakeholders and beta staff testers to make sure a seamless end-user expertise. By securing suggestions from testers and visionaries, the Senior Java Developer can add, take away, and debug features essential to the project’s overall success. They are also considered as a group chief who may delegate these duties to different developers who focus solely on program architecture. There may be extra depending on the project and the developer’s role on the staff.

  • Understanding the multifaceted function of a Java developer is crucial for both aspiring professionals and organizations looking to leverage Java’s capabilities.
  • Employers often search candidates who can demonstrate their capability to adapt to completely different technologies and frameworks, as this flexibility is crucial in a quickly changing tech panorama.
  • Check out the video under that can enlighten you with various skillsets required by Java Developers in the varied domains of the current IT Trade.

Financial Providers

Let’s break down what a typical week in the life of a Java developer looks like. Java developers are the brains behind the apps and methods we use every day. From cellular apps and banking software program to person suggestions and enormous enterprise platforms. If you are interested in expanding beyond backend improvement, discover our full information to becoming a Java full stack developer to learn to construct full web purposes from frontend to backend. Pair Programming and MentoringSenior developers typically pair program with junior builders, sharing data and finest practices. This collaborative method helps preserve code high quality and accelerates learning.

role of java developer

Successful collaboration also requires emotional intelligence, as developers should navigate completely different personalities and work styles. Being capable of empathize with staff members and perceive their perspectives can lead to a extra harmonious and productive work setting. Developers are often confronted with advanced challenges that require progressive options. This skill entails not simply identifying problems but also analyzing them, brainstorming potential options, and implementing one of the best course of action. Tailoring learning experiences further, professionals can maximise value with customisable Course Bundles of TKA.

Working with frameworks like Spring and knowledge of databases, Model Control techniques, and agile methodologies are additionally essential. Java Developers contribute across a variety of industries, corresponding to finance, healthcare, e-commerce, and telecommunications. Their proficiency in Java allows them to develop functions which are each secure and scalable, guaranteeing optimal performance. In the midst of reaching a Java Developer’s Goal, they play an important function in guaranteeing that purposes function efficiently and fulfill the unique requirements of businesses and customers.

The Best Practices For Hiring A React Developer – Simplify Your Hiring Process

Learn the means to write a Java developer job description that may appeal to top talent, with examples, a template and role overview. As a Java developer, your code ought to be simple to learn and comprehend but easy to take care of. Moreover, in case your code is well-documented, it turns into a collaborative asset, fostering efficient teamwork and information sharing.

This information covers every little thing from firm types to advantages of expanding your small business in Croatia. The backend developer focuses on server-side utility logic and integration. Java developers don’t just code; they also maintain present codebases by debugging, figuring out points, and optimizing code for higher performance. They are sometimes answerable for creating take a look at circumstances to make sure the software’s reliability. Both JUnit and TestNG play an important function in guaranteeing that Java functions are thoroughly tested and meet high quality requirements earlier than deployment. Additionally, together with links to the source code on platforms like GitHub can present potential employers with perception into the developer’s coding fashion and problem-solving talents.

For Example Java Web Service, REST API, SOAP API, JSON, XML, and other related subjects. Another essential factor about Java interviews is questions primarily based upon Java programming language and JDK API. Since Java can be an Object-oriented programming language, you will discover a lot of OOP questions there. As a Java developer, you’ll be a half of the IT/Software Product staff within a corporation https://deveducation.com/. Relying on how your enterprise is structured, there could possibly be a single software program team, or much smaller software teams that work on individual initiatives typically practiced in agile environments. Java Build ToolsA skillful developer should be conversant in steady integration (CI) and continuous deployment (CD).

Mastery of these abilities not solely enhances a developer’s ability to create high-quality applications but in addition positions them as valuable contributors to any software growth staff. In the ever-evolving panorama of software growth, a Java developer’s function is pivotal in creating sturdy, scalable, and efficient applications. To excel in this place, a developer should possess a diverse set of technical abilities and tools. Java developers play a vital function in the software program development lifecycle, leveraging their expertise in the Java programming language to create sturdy, scalable, and environment friendly purposes.

Questa voce è stata pubblicata in IT Education. Contrassegna il permalink.